Large Cap

Shares are divi­ded into large caps, mid caps and small caps accor­ding to their market capi­ta­liza­tion, wher­eby the term “cap” is short for capi­ta­liza­tion. Market capi­ta­liza­tion is calcu­la­ted by multi­ply­ing the number of shares of the company traded on the stock exch­ange by the current share price. Large caps, the compa­nies with the highest stock market value, include those with a market capi­ta­liza­tion of over two billion euros. Mid caps are compa­nies with a market capi­ta­liza­tion of between 500 million and two billion euros, while small caps have a market capi­ta­liza­tion of less than half a billion euros. Small caps are the equity cate­gory with the highest expec­ted returns.
